Victor Vasarely was married to Claire Spinner and had two sons, Andre and Jean-Pierre. His family life was generally private, and he preferred to focus on his art and career rather than share details about his personal life.

The Giver warned Jonas about having a spouse and children because it would create emotional attachments and distractions that could jeopardize his ability to carry out his role as the Receiver of Memories. Having personal relationships could complicate his decisions and emotions, potentially interfering with his responsibilities.
